|
查看: 1385|回复: 6
|
请求关于Java 的 JFrame
[复制链接]
|
|
|
有人会在 JFrame 做 calculation 吗?老师给的功课是关于一个快餐店的OrderForm,
老师要我们做个calculation,
例如客人要求添加饮料,小吃之类,
然后客人在check box 上打勾,
下面的text field 就会自动做calculation,
而且还要 rounding off 的 
有哪位大大可以指点指点吗?
现在小弟不会写calculation >< |
|
|
|
|
|
|
|
|
|
|
发表于 22-5-2011 08:29 PM
|
显示全部楼层
回复 1# enzoboy
如果Check box 被打勾的话
就用 .isSelected()
Display 价钱是用 JLabel
JTextField 是给人家key in 资料的
如果要Calculation
可以开一个method
Example:
public void calculate(){
}
Calculate 的 Button 要开Action Listener
Example:
jbtCalculate.addActionListener(
new ActionListener(){
public void actionPerformed(ActionEvent e){
calculate();
}
}
);
希望可以帮到你咯
哈哈 |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 22-5-2011 08:54 PM
|
显示全部楼层
回复 enzoboy
如果Check box 被打勾的话
就用 .isSelected()
Display 价钱是用 JLabel
...
小辉仔 发表于 22-5-2011 08:29 PM  谢谢大大了!
还有一事相求,
请问大大可以教教小弟 return statement 这些什么时候用的吗?
method overloading 也是 >< |
|
|
|
|
|
|
|
|
|
|
发表于 22-5-2011 09:07 PM
|
显示全部楼层
回复 3# enzoboy
Method Overloading 是两个method 可是 with the same name
public static double calculate(argument1, argument2)
{
//code
}
public static int calculate (argument1,argument2)
{
//code
}
return statement 是在一个method 里面
好像当要calculate num1 and num2的和数
就在method 里return 和数到void main 那边
return statement 就是你要保留的东西,然后需要传送到void main 的东西
希望对你有帮助
哈哈 |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 22-5-2011 09:12 PM
|
显示全部楼层
回复 enzoboy
Method Overloading 是两个method 可是 with the same name
public static d ...
小辉仔 发表于 22-5-2011 09:07 PM  真的是感激不尽了 ><
小弟的老师都是用英语教学的,
听不太明白
现在大概大概明白了 XD
谢谢  |
|
|
|
|
|
|
|
|
|
|
发表于 22-5-2011 09:13 PM
|
显示全部楼层
回复 5# enzoboy
因为之前有拿了Object oriented programming 这一个科目
所以略懂
哈哈
到现在过了一年多了 也快遗忘了  |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 22-5-2011 09:15 PM
|
显示全部楼层
回复 enzoboy
因为之前有拿了Object oriented programming 这一个科目
所以略懂
哈哈
到现 ...
小辉仔 发表于 22-5-2011 09:13 PM  哦~原来...
小弟是主修programming 的 
多多指教 |
|
|
|
|
|
|
|
|
| |
本周最热论坛帖子
|